04 2021 档案

摘要:1、Set接口 Set继承于Collection接口,是一个不允许出现重复元素,并且无序的集合,主要有HashSet和TreeSet两大实现类。在判断重复元素的时候,Set集合会调用hashCode()和equal()方法来实现。 HashSet是哈希表结构,主要利用HashMap的key来存储元素 阅读全文
posted @ 2021-04-11 23:37 jrliu 阅读(278) 评论(0) 推荐(0) 编辑
摘要:1、LinkedList简介 LinkedList是一个实现了List接口和Deque接口的双端链表。 LinkedList底层的双向链表结构使它支持高效的插入和删除操作,但是很明显查找修改慢。另外它实现了Deque接口,使得LinkedList类也具有队列的特性; LinkedList不是线程安全 阅读全文
posted @ 2021-04-08 19:35 jrliu 阅读(387) 评论(0) 推荐(0) 编辑
摘要:1、ArrayList简介 ArrayList的底层是数组队列,相当于动态数组。与Java中的数组相比,它的容量能动态增长。在添加大量元素前,应用程序可以使用ensureCapacity操作来增加ArrayList实例的容量。这可以减少递增式再分配的数量。这样解决了数组在初始化的时候必须要指定大小, 阅读全文
posted @ 2021-04-05 11:23 jrliu 阅读(160) 评论(0) 推荐(0) 编辑
摘要:1、前言 Java集合就像一个容器,可以存储任何类型的数据,也可以结合泛型来存储具体的类型对象。在程序运行时,Java集合可以动态的进行扩展,随着元素的增加而扩大。在Java中,集合类通常存在于java.util包中。Java集合主要由2大体系构成,分别是Collection体系和Map体系,其中C 阅读全文
posted @ 2021-04-04 20:44 jrliu 阅读(98)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示